Course Content

• Technical Terminology and its Translation
• Software Localization and Internationalization (L10n & I18n)
• Translation Memory (TM) and Computer-Assisted Translation (CAT) Tools
• Quality Assurance (QA) in Technical Translation
• Technical Content Translation Project Management
• DTP and Technical File Formats (e.g., XML, InDesign)
• Specialized Technical Fields (e.g., Medical, Automotive, IT)
• Understanding of Target Audience and Culture
• Legal and Ethical Considerations in Technical Translation

Becoming a Certified Professional in Technical Content Translation signifies expertise in adapting technical documents across languages, ensuring accuracy and cultural relevance. This certification demonstrates a deep understanding of technical terminology, localization best practices, and translation technologies.


Learning outcomes for a Certified Professional in Technical Content Translation program typically include mastering terminology management, using CAT tools (computer-assisted translation), and navigating the complexities of technical writing across various fields like engineering, software, and medicine. Graduates confidently handle specialized glossaries, style guides, and quality assurance processes.
